With the end of the war, operations at the base came to a virtual standstill.
It was then the base was selected as a storage site for hundreds of decommissioned aircraft with the activation of the 4105th Army Air Force Unit.
The 4105th oversaw the storage of excess B-29s and C-47 " Gooney Birds.
" Tucson's dry climate and alkali soil made it an ideal location for aircraft storage and preservation, a mission that has continued to this day.
The airfield also acted as a separation center, which brought the base populace to a high of 11, 614 people in September 1945.
